our story

The Creative OTR is inspired by the therapeutic potential of art and play to support children and youth at all stages of development. Art-based activity kits and games are created to provide a fun and motivational approach to support each child’s strengths and support their needs. The kits can be used in multiple occupational therapy settings, schools, and home to promote skills that carryover for participating in meaningful occupations.

About our kits

  • The dynamic kits support multiple developmental skills including fine motor, visual motor, visual perception, gross motor, executive function, and sensory processing in a fun and creative way.

  • The art-based kits are developed through an occupational therapy lens. They are applied and refined to provide high quality products promoting developmental skills in a fun and engaging way.

    Through hands on application of the art-based activities kits valuable experience and insight is gained from children of various ages, strengths, and needs across multiple settings. While the kits were in use, the greatest need for adaptation was observed leading to intentional upgrades, downgrades (adjusting difficulty level) and supplemental activities to support the unique qualities and goals of each child.

    By bridging a kinesthetic hands-on approach with technology and fun themes these kits can bring a fresh and exciting perspective to promoting pediatric skill development.

  • The art-based kits facilitate children’s intrinsic motivation and occupational participation while also increasing efficiency for occupational therapy practitioners and documentation supports. The kits include:

    • supplies

    • complete activity guide

    • documentation supports

    • therapeutic benefits

    • supplemental ideas

    • flexible ideas to increase or decrease difficulty level

    • visual and written step-by-step directions

    • developmental skill guide

    • progress monitoring chart

    To increase the flexibility of the kits to meet individual goals and needs, therapeutic benefits, upgrades, downgrades, and supplemental ideas have been applied and are provided with each kit.
